He was sending out so many signs he was interested, now he's just shut down...

A female United States age 30-35, anonymous writes:

I really like this guy who goes to my church... He is my good friends older brother (only a year older than me). when she found out i like him, she took my phone from me and texted him from it so that i would have his number cuz i was too afraid to ask. he texted back the next day and we texted everyday until church that sunday. on sunday, we went and hung out with other people from church and we ate lunch and went to a movie.. he seemed kind of into me, he sat by me the whole time and we talked a lot. then later that night he texted me and said he wished he would have talked to me more when he had the chance... we texted eachother everyday after that and we saw eachother at church on sundays and wednesdays.

last week he asked me if i wanted to hang out with him and his sister and her boyfriend. we had a great time! he said he had a lot of fun and then on sunday i hung out with him from 11:00 am (when church started) until 10 pm. we hung out at his house and watched movies and played games... it was super fun! and on monday he chatted with me on facebook and we talked for a while and then he said he had to go because he had a huge paper to write for school but he would text me later. he never texted me again that night and the next day he only sent me one message and it said good luck, because i had a game that night. then on wednesday at church we didn't talk much at all. on thursday he didn't text me so i figured it would be okay for me to text him because he always texts me first, when he texted back he didn't seem very happy to talk to me. he usually has cute things to say and he always puts smiley faces in all of his texts. but this time he didn't... he just had blunt, straight-forward, and not very interesting replies.. then on friday i didn't talk to him once and today i got on facebook and i looked at my online friends and he was on but he got off right away... he always chats with me when we are on at the same time.

I really don't know what is happening... he was sending out soooo many signs that he was interested but then all of a sudden he just shut down... i am going to see him tomorrow at church but i don't know what to say. any ideas what i should say or why this is all happening?? thanks.

A reader, anonymous, writes (24 October 2010):

This sounds like shyness here and thus probably an insecurity he has. So, talk to him about it and assure him its okay and relay your feelings towards him clearly face to face so that he will genuinely see how you feel and will therefore be more apt to reciprocate the same back to you. Good luck.

A male reader, anonymous, writes (24 October 2010):

Have you considered that he might be shy? Perhaps he really does like you but he's not sure how to show it and if he's REALLY religious then he might be feeling guilty about liking you. Try and draw him out of his shell a bit more, it might be good for both of you.
